Djamel Fezari, professionally known as Kore, is a French DJ, music producer, composer, and entrepreneur who became widely recognized as one of the leading architects of modern French urban music.
He gained major visibility through his fusion of French hip-hop, rhythm and blues, and North African raï influences within the mainstream European music industry.
Trending Now!!:
His breakthrough arrived during the early 2000s after launching the successful Rai’N’B Fever series, a musical project that united major French rap artists with Algerian and Moroccan vocalists.
Beyond his success as a producer, his long-running influence in talent development and executive music production established him as a central figure within contemporary French pop culture.

Early Life and Education
Djamel Fezari, publicly known as Kore, was born on 16 January 1978 in Paris, France and is now at the age of 48 years old.
He was raised in a multicultural environment heavily influenced by French street culture and North African traditions, which later shaped the sound direction of his music career.
He grew up alongside his younger brother Bellek, who later entered the music business and became one of his closest collaborators in studio production.
During his childhood and teenage years, he developed a strong interest in turntables, sampling equipment, and underground hip-hop culture while attending local schools in Paris throughout the 1980s and 1990s.
Although detailed academic records connected to higher education remain unavailable, he shifted his full concentration toward music production during his teenage years and began building experience within independent DJ circles before eventually entering the professional recording industry.

Career
Kore began his professional music career during the late 1990s as the French urban music movement expanded across major cities. He first gained underground attention through mixtape production and DJ performances before forming the production duo Kore and Skalp alongside Pascal Boniani Koeu.
The duo secured a recording agreement with Sony Music France in 2001 and quickly became known for producing major records for artists including Rohff, Booba, Willy Denzey, and M. Pokora.
His major breakthrough arrived through the launch of the Raï’N’B Fever project, which successfully blended North African raï music with French rap and rhythm and blues.
The series became commercially successful across Europe and North Africa, establishing him as one of the most influential producers within the French-speaking urban music industry.
Following the separation of Kore and Skalp in 2006, he continued independently by founding Artop Studios and expanding his production work internationally.
During the 2010s, he collaborated with international artists including Rick Ross, French Montana, and Kid Cudi while also contributing to the rise of major French rap artists such as Lacrim and SCH through the successful mixtape A7.
His continued involvement in artist management, executive production, and soundtrack composition allowed him to remain highly active within the European entertainment sector.

Discography
- Raï’N’B Fever (2004)
- Raï’N’B Fever 2 (2006)
- Raï’N’B Fever 3 (2008)
- Raï’N’B Fever 4 (2011)
